Introduction to Climate-Controlled Warehousing

Climate-controlled warehouses are specialized storage facilities designed to maintain specific environmental conditions throughout the year. Unlike traditional storage options that provide basic protection from the elements, climate-controlled warehouses are equipped with advanced heating, ventilation, and air conditioning (HVAC) systems to regulate temperature and humidity levels. This meticulous control is crucial for preserving the quality of various goods, especially those sensitive to environmental fluctuations.

In Ukraine, climate-controlled warehousing has gained prominence across multiple industries. For example, the food and beverage sector relies heavily on these facilities to ensure the freshness and safety of perishable items, such as dairy products and sealed meats. By maintaining optimal storage conditions, businesses can extend product shelf life, reduce spoilage, and comply with stringent health regulations. Similarly, pharmaceuticals and biotechnology companies utilize climate-controlled environments to protect sensitive medications and research materials from temperature extremes and humidity.

Furthermore, the significance of climate-controlled warehouses extends beyond product preservation. These facilities facilitate enhanced inventory management and help businesses adapt to evolving market demands. In a global economy marked by rapid change, the ability to store goods in ideal conditions can provide a substantial competitive advantage. This is particularly relevant for Ukrainian exporters aiming to penetrate international markets, where compliance with quality standards is paramount.

In summary, climate-controlled warehousing in Ukraine plays an integral role in safeguarding products across diverse industries. By providing a solution that not only protects goods but also enhances operational efficiency, these specialized facilities exemplify the modernization of storage practices essential for thriving in today’s market landscapes.

Industry-Specific Needs: Agriculture and Pharmaceuticals

The agricultural and pharmaceutical industries in Ukraine demonstrate distinct climate control requirements due to the sensitive nature of their products. These sectors necessitate a stable environment, ensuring the quality and longevity of goods stored within climate-controlled warehouses. For agriculture, particularly, temperature and humidity levels are crucial in preserving perishable items such as fruits, vegetables, and dairy products. Many agricultural goods are vulnerable to spoilage and degradation; thus, maintaining a consistently cool temperature alongside appropriate humidity levels is paramount. This prevents mold growth and maintains freshness, directly impacting marketability and consumer satisfaction.

On the other hand, the pharmaceutical industry has its unique challenges regarding climate control. Many pharmaceutical products, including vaccines, biologics, and certain drug formulations, are highly sensitive to temperature fluctuations and humidity. The stability of these products can be compromised if exposed to conditions outside their specified range—often requiring temperatures between 2°C and 8°C for optimal storage. Climate-controlled warehouses in this sector play a pivotal role not only in maintaining these specific conditions but also in adhering to regulatory standards, ensuring that pharmaceuticals do not lose efficacy or pose safety risks to consumers.

In light of these requirements, investing in climate-controlled warehousing solutions becomes vital for both industries. Such facilities provide the necessary infrastructure to monitor and adjust environmental conditions in real-time, catering to the specific demands of agricultural and pharmaceutical products. By ensuring that these goods are stored under optimal conditions, businesses can mitigate losses due to spoilage and maintain compliance with health regulations, ultimately supporting the overarching goals of both sectors to deliver safe and high-quality products to the market.

Impact of Ukrainian Climate on Warehousing

Ukraine experiences a diverse continental climate characterized by significant seasonal variations in temperature and weather patterns. The regions within Ukraine can be broadly categorized into three climatic zones: the western, central, and eastern parts, each exhibiting its own unique weather influences. In the winter months, temperatures in northern Ukraine can plunge below -20 degrees Celsius, whereas the southern regions experience milder winters. Conversely, summer temperatures can soar, especially in July and August, reaching above 30 degrees Celsius, particularly in the southern regions. This wide temperature range necessitates the integration of climate-controlled warehouses to safeguard products from the adverse effects of extreme weather.

Aside from temperature fluctuations, Ukraine is also subject to varying humidity levels and precipitation rates throughout the year. The winter months tend to bring substantial snowfall, while summer often sees high humidity and rainfall. Such conditions can adversely affect the integrity of stored goods, particularly sensitive items like pharmaceuticals, food products, and electronics, which require stable climates to prevent spoilage or degradation. Implementing climate control systems in warehouses allows for the regulation of both temperature and humidity, ensuring that products are maintained within optimal parameters regardless of external weather conditions.

Furthermore, the unpredictability of climate patterns, exacerbated by global climate change, makes it all the more critical for Ukrainian businesses to invest in climate-controlled warehousing solutions. Extended periods of heat waves or unseasonable cold can disrupt supply chains and impact overall product quality. As a proactive measure, climate-controlled warehouses not only mitigate these risks but also enhance operational efficiency by providing a reliable environment for storage throughout all four seasons. The need for such facilities in Ukraine underscores the importance of addressing climatic influence on warehousing solutions.

Technological Advancements in Climate Control

In recent years, the importance of climate-controlled warehouses in Ukraine has gained significant traction, driven by technological advancements that enhance efficiency and reliability. A key innovation in this arena is the use of Internet of Things (IoT) sensors. These devices play a vital role in monitoring environmental conditions within warehouses, collecting real-time data on temperature, humidity, and air quality. By leveraging this data, facility managers can make informed decisions that ensure optimal storage conditions for sensitive goods, thereby reducing the risk of spoilage or damage.

Additionally, automation is transforming the landscape of temperature regulation within warehouses. Automated climate control systems can adjust settings on the fly based on the data received from IoT sensors. This not only optimizes energy consumption but also maintains a stable environment for stored products. For instance, if the temperature deviates from the designated range, the system can automatically activate heating or cooling mechanisms, minimizing the need for manual intervention. The resulting operational efficiency translates into significant cost savings for warehouse operations in Ukraine.

Remote monitoring systems are another pivotal technological development in climate control. These systems allow warehouse managers to oversee environmental conditions from virtually anywhere, via smartphones or computers. This remote access ensures that any issues can be promptly addressed, thus safeguarding the integrity of the stored items. Furthermore, these systems often incorporate predictive analytics, which can foresee potential temperature fluctuations based on historical data and current trends, allowing for proactive measures to be taken. As such, advancements in climate control technologies not only refine operational protocols but also bolster the adaptability and resilience of Ukrainian warehouses.

Regulatory Standards and Compliance in Ukraine

In Ukraine, the operation of climate-controlled warehouses is deeply intertwined with regulatory standards and compliance requirements aimed at ensuring the safety of products and consumers. These warehouses must adhere to both national and international regulations to maintain their operational integrity and preserve the quality of stored goods. The regulatory landscape necessitates adherence to specific standards related to temperature control, humidity levels, and overall facility design.

One of the primary pillars of compliance in Ukraine is the Law on the Protection of Consumer Rights, which mandates that all goods stored in warehouses meet designated safety standards. Under this regulation, climate-controlled warehouses are required to regularly ensure that their storage conditions adhere to the prescribed temperature and humidity levels to prevent spoilage or degradation of products. This is particularly relevant for sensitive items such as pharmaceuticals, food products, and other perishables, which can be adversely impacted by improper conditions.

Additionally, the Ukrainian government enforces safety standards that are critical for the operation of these warehouses. Inspections are conducted by relevant authorities to evaluate compliance with these standards, which encompass structural integrity, fire safety measures, and environmental control systems within the facility. Registrations and certifications of the warehouse’s cooling and heating systems are also crucial to confirm that they meet the necessary operational efficiency and environmental regulations.

Lastly, adherence to international guidelines, such as those set by the ISO (International Organization for Standardization), further supplements national legislation. This alignment not only enhances the credibility of climate-controlled warehouses in Ukraine but also facilitates trade and builds trust among international partners. Compliance with these extensive regulations is essential for ensuring that climate-controlled warehouses not only operate efficiently but also maintain the highest standards of safety and quality for their stored products.
